Citation and construction
1. (1) These Regulations may be cited as the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) (Amendment) (No. 1) Regulations 2017.
(2) These Regulations and the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) Regulations 2007 to 2015 shall be construed together as one and may be cited together as the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) Regulations 2007 to 2017.
Commencement
2. These Regulations come into operation—
(a) in so far as they relate to injury benefit, on 13 March 2017, and
(b) in so far as they relate to disablement pension and disablement gratuity, on 17 March 2017.
Definition
3. In these Regulations “the Principal Regulations” means the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) Regulations 2007 (
S.I. No. 102 of 2007
).
Increased rates of benefits and pensions under the occupational injuries scheme
4. The Principal Regulations are amended by—
(a) the substitution of the Schedule set out in Schedule A to these Regulations for Schedule 1 (amended by article 4 the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) (Amendment) Regulations 2010 (
S.I. No 683 of 2010
)), and
(b) the substitution of the Schedules set out in Schedule B to these Regulations for Schedule 3 (amended by article 4 of the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) (Amendment) Regulations 2010) (
S.I. No 683 of 2010
)), and Schedule 3A (inserted by article 6 of the Social Welfare (Consolidated Occupational Injuries) (Amendment) (No. 2) Regulations 2011 (
S.I. No 730 of 2011
), subject in respect of the Scales set out in the said Schedule B, to the following provisions—
(i) the rates of pension specified in columns (3) of the Scales shall have effect on and from 17 March 2017 whether the period taken into account by the assessment began on, before, or after that date, and,
(ii) the amounts of gratuity specified in columns (2) of the Scales shall be payable only where the period taken into account by the assessment of the degree of disablement began on or after 17 March 2017.

EXPLANATORY NOTE
(This note is not part of the Instrument and does not purport to be a legal interpretation.)
Section 21 of, and Schedule 1 to, the
Social Welfare Act 2016
provide for an increase in the maximum rate of Injury Benefit payable from 13 March 2017 and for increases in the rates of benefits payable under the Occupational Injuries Benefits Scheme from 17 March 2017. Parts 2-3 of Schedule 1 provide for increases to the maximum rate of Disablement Gratuity and the weekly rates of Disablement Pension where the degree of disablement ranges from 100 per cent to 20 per cent.
These Regulations provide for increases in the rate of Disablement Gratuity and the weekly rates of Disablement Pension where the degree of disablement ranges from 1 per cent to 19 per cent. The rates provided for in Schedule 3 apply in respect of a continuing disablement of between 1 and 19 per cent which arose prior to 1 January 2012. Schedule 3A applies where the disablement occurs after 1 January 2012 and in such a case, Disablement Gratuity and Disablement Pension are payable only where the extent of disablement is greater than 14 per cent.
The Regulations also provide for an increase in the rate of Injury Benefit payable to persons under the age of sixteen. If, in such a case, there is what amounts to full-time employment, or substantially full-time employment, the weekly rate will increase by €5.00 (from €188.00 to €193.00). This is the same rate as the maximum rate payable to an adult. In all other cases the rate will increase by €2.40 (from €89.90 to €92.30).
The rate increases provided for by these Regulations come into effect on 13 March 2017 in the case of Injury Benefit and on 17 March 2017 in the case of Disablement Gratuity and Disablement Pension to coincide with the increases in rates provided for by the
Social Welfare Act 2016
.
